Job Summary We are seeking a highly organized, proactive, and discreet Executive Administrative Assistant to provide comprehensive support to our senior leadership team at our U.S. Headquarters in Mesa, AZ. The ideal candidate will thrive in a fast-paced, innovative environment, managing complex schedules, coordinating travel, and handling confidential information with the utmost professionalism. This role is essential to ensuring smooth operations and allowing executives to focus on strategic growth in the rapidly expanding climate solutions industry.


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and maintain executive calendars, including scheduling meetings, appointments, and conference calls across multiple time zones.
  • Coordinate domestic and international travel arrangements, including flights, accommodations, transportation, and detailed itineraries.
  • Prepare and edit correspondence, reports, presentations, and other documents on behalf of executives.
  • Screen and prioritize incoming calls, emails, and requests; act as a gatekeeper to optimize executive time.
  • Organize and coordinate executive meetings, board preparations, and company events, including agenda preparation, minute-taking, and follow-up on action items.
  • Handle expense reports, budget tracking, and invoice processing in compliance with company policies.
  • Maintain confidential files and records, ensuring secure handling of sensitive information.
  • Liaise with internal teams, external stakeholders, vendors, and partners to facilitate communication and project coordination.
  • Assist with special projects, research, and administrative tasks as needed to support company initiatives.
  • Oversee general office support functions, such as supply management and visitor coordination, as required.


Qualifications and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Communications, or a related field preferred; equivalent experience accepted.
  • 5+ years of experience as an Executive Assistant or Administrative Assistant supporting C-level executives or senior leadership.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ple priorities in a dynamic, high-growth environment.
  • Exceptional organizational skills with keen attention to detail and problem-solving abilities.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ills; professional demeanor and emotional intelligence.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and calendar management tools; experience with collaboration software (e.g., Teams, Zoom) a plus.
  • High level of discretion and integrity when handling confidential information.
  • Ability to work independently, anticipate needs, and exercise sound judgment.
  • Flexibility to occasionally work outside standard hours for urgent matters or travel support.
  • Experience in manufacturing, technology, or sustainability sectors is a plus.
